/** Add context to ChokidarEvents, turning them into LocalEvents.
*
* When applying remote changes on the local filesystem for paths containing
* utf8 characters, the encoding can be automatically and silently modified by
* the filesystem itself. For example, HFS+ volumes will normalize UTF-8
* characters using NFD
* (c.f. {@link https://en.wikipedia.org/wiki/Unicode_equivalence#Normalization}).
*
* When this happens, the local watcher will fire events for paths which aren't
* exactly equal to the ones that were merged from the remote changes, leading
* to the detection of a move which will then be synchronized with the remote
* and so on.
*
* To avoid those "leaks" which can create conflicts or at least extraneous
* changes on existing documents, we normalize on the fly the event's path
* using NFC so we won't detect movements when only the encoding has changed.
*
* @see method {@link oldMetadata} for existing Metadata path normalization
* @see method {@link step} for current events path normalization
* @see {@link module:core/metadata|Metadata#idApfsOrHfs} for id normalization
*
* @module core/local/chokidar/prepare_events
* @flow
*
*/

/**
* Returns the Metadata stored in Pouch associated with the given event's path.
*
* @return Metadata
*/
const oldMetadata = async (
e /*: ChokidarEvent */,
pouch /*: Pouch */
) /*: Promise<?Metadata> */ => {
if (e.old) return e.old
const old /*: ?Metadata */ = await pouch.bySyncedPath(e.path)
if (old && !old.trashed) return old
}
